## Authentication

Quick context before you dive into the diff: now that the profile store is sharded across the three Quillbrook clusters, every read goes through the shard-router instead of hitting Postgres directly. The router won't talk to anonymous callers anymore — each service authenticates with a scoped key, and the router maps that key to an allowed shard range. Tests mock this, but if you want to poke the staging router yourself while reviewing, use the shared staging key, which is pasted just below.

app token of tagef-tafog = qvz3-7n0

Subject: Key rotation — Catalog cache invalidation

Heads up: we rotated the credentials for Purgely, the internal service that invalidates product-catalog cache entries after price and stock updates. Old key dies at 02:00 tomorrow. If invalidations stall after cutover, you'll see stale prices on the storefront and a growing backlog in the Purgely queue — restart the invalidation workers with the new key and the backlog drains on its own. Update the on-call env before the cutover window. The new Purgely key follows.

app token of bahaf-tajeg = zpat23_SjjsllwiLmXbtS65veZaV47

Leadership Review Briefing — Supplier Renewal

Sales leads: the Korvane Materials contract expires at quarter end. Renewal terms hold pricing flat for eighteen months with improved delivery windows. Alternatives were benchmarked; none matched lead times. We recommend signing before the deadline. The confidential note below sets out how this renewal supports our expansion plans.

internal memo for kawip-hadug: Headcount on the Wenwyn team goes from 7 to 140 by the end of January. Gross margin on Wenwyn came in at 20 percent against a plan of 15 percent.